Pure Energy Minerals (CVE:PE) Sets New 1-Year High – Here’s Why

Pure Energy Minerals Limited (CVE:PEGet Free Report)’s stock price reached a new 52-week high during trading on Tuesday . The company traded as high as C$0.43 and last traded at C$0.43, with a volume of 31192 shares trading hands. The stock had previously closed at C$0.35.

Pure Energy Minerals Stock Up 25.7%

The stock’s 50-day simple moving average is C$0.31 and its 200 day simple moving average is C$0.27. The firm has a market cap of C$14.95 million, a P/E ratio of -44.00 and a beta of -2.30.

Pure Energy Minerals Limited acquires, explores, and develops mineral properties. Its primary project is the Clayton Valley lithium brine project located in Clayton Valley, Esmeralda County, Nevada. The company was formerly known as Harmony Gold Corp. and changed its name to Pure Energy Minerals Limited in October 2012. Pure Energy Minerals Limited is headquartered in Vancouver, Canada.
